What:
The Breakfast Book Club (BBC) is a book club to engage 4th, 5th and 6th grade learners in additional literacy opportunities throughout the year. The reading list is an abbreviated version of the current year's Battle of the Books list. Moving at a relaxed pace of one book every two weeks (versus one book per week in BOB).
 
Learners will meet to discuss the featured book over breakfast and work on a fun project that relates to what they're reading. The goal is for learners to develop a deeper understanding of each book, consider others’ perspectives, make predictions and solve problems, try out expanded vocabulary and practice analyzing what he/she read.
 
Participation does not require reading log completion, extra studying, tests, or competition - just a commitment to read the books on the reading list and thoughtfully participate in group discussions. Members are strongly encouraged to read at least 6 of the 12 books.
